The SchedulerGroupItem type exposes the following members.

Methods

  Name Description
Public method CheckAccess (Inherited from DependencyObject.)
Public method ClearValue
Clears the local value of a property. The property to be cleared is specified by a DependencyProperty identifier.
(Inherited from DependencyObject.)
Public method Equals
Determines whether the specified Object is equal to the current Object.
(Inherited from Object.)
Protected method Finalize
Allows an Object to attempt to free resources and perform other cleanup operations before the Object is reclaimed by garbage collection.
(Inherited from Object.)
Public method GetAnimationBaseValue (Inherited from DependencyObject.)
Public method GetHashCode
Serves as a hash function for a particular type.
(Inherited from Object.)
Public method GetType
Gets the Type of the current instance.
(Inherited from Object.)
Public method GetValue
Returns the current effective value of a dependency property on this instance of a DependencyObject.
(Inherited from DependencyObject.)
Protected method MemberwiseClone
Creates a shallow copy of the current Object.
(Inherited from Object.)
Public method ReadLocalValue
Returns the local value of a dependency property, if it exists.
(Inherited from DependencyObject.)
Public method SetValue
Sets the local value of a dependency property, specified by its dependency property identifier.
(Inherited from DependencyObject.)
Public method ToString
Returns the string representation of the current SchedulerGroupItem object.
(Overrides Object..::..ToString()()()().)

Fields

  Name Description
Public field Static member BackgroundProperty
Identifies the Background dependency property.
Public field Static member DisplayNameProperty
Identifies the DisplayName dependency property.
Public field Static member HasVisibleAppointmentsProperty
Identifies the HasVisibleAppointments dependency property.
Public field Static member IsSelectedProperty
Identifies the IsSelected dependency property.
Public field Static member ShowNextButtonProperty
Identifies the ShowNextButton dependency property.
Public field Static member ShowPreviousButtonProperty
Identifies the ShowPreviousButton dependency property.
Public field Static member TagProperty
Identifies the Tag dependency property.

Properties

  Name Description
Public property Background
Gets or sets the Brush objects which should be used as background color for UI, representing the SchedulerGroupItem object. This is a dependency property.
Public property Dispatcher (Inherited from DependencyObject.)
Public property DisplayName
Gets or sets the String value representing the display name of the SchedulerGroupItem object. This is a dependency property.
Public property HasVisibleAppointments
Indicates whether there is at least one visible appointment in the current view. This is a dependency property.
Public property IsChecked
Gets or sets a Boolean value determinign whether this SchedulerGroupItem object should be displayed in UI.
Public property IsSelected
Gets or sets a value that determines whether the UI element that has this SchedulerGroupItem as a DataContext is selected. This is a dependency property.
Public property Name
Gets the String value representing the name of the SchedulerGroupItem object.
Public property Owner
Gets the BaseObject object representing the SchedulerGroupItem object owner. This property can be null for an empty group item.
Public property Scheduler
Gets the Scheduler that SchedulerGroupItem belongs to.
Public property ShowNextButton
Gets or sets a value that determines whether to show the next group navigation button (buttons). The default value is True. This is a dependency property.
Public property ShowPreviousButton
Gets or sets a value that determines whether to show the previous group navigation button (buttons). The default value is True. This is a dependency property.
Public property Tag
Gets or sets the object that contains custom data about the SchedulerGroupItem object. This is a dependency property.
Public property VisualIntervalGroups
Gets a collection of VisualIntervalGroup objects defining top-level groups of VisualInterval objects currently represented by the control on a screen.
Public property VisualIntervals
Gets a collection of VisualInterval objects defining time intervals currently represented by the control on a screen.
Public property VisualIntervalsView
Gets a grouped view on the VisualIntervals collection.

See Also